Reviewed by Tony Cummings

Possibly a more appropriate title would be 'Getting Excited About His Promise'. For this is gospel worship at its most exuberant. This is Youthful Praise's fifth album and with their trademark East Coast choir sound it can't be bettered. All the elements are in place - J J's memorable melodies and charismatic presence every bit as dominant as Kirk Franklin's, a surging, foot-stomping rhythm section from the joyful opener "You Reign" opener (seven minutes, 17 secs) to the staccato-phrased closer "You Can Make It" (five mins, 11 secs) and an electrifying live atmosphere this is dynamic trad gospel of the finest quality. As the capper JJ brings in some special guests to raise the anti to exploding point. So we've got the smouldering emoting of the First Lady Of Gospel, Shirley Caesar, on "High Praise", the rasping exhortations of Myron Butler on "Great Expectation" and the incomparable Dorinda Clark-Cole taking it to the heavenlies on "What A Mighty God We Serve". If you thought trad choir music had lost much of its zest and fire, here's the album to change your mind. My only regret is that I wasn't present at the Cathedral Of Praise in Bridgeport, Connecticut to get my praise on when this smouldering set was recorded.
